art risk life insurance is a specialized type of insurance that aims to protect art collectors and institutions from the risks associated with owning and displaying valuable art pieces. This type of insurance coverage goes beyond the typical property insurance policies and offers added protection specifically tailored to the unique risks involved with owning art.

One of the main benefits of art risk life insurance is the coverage it provides in case of damage or loss to the art piece. While property insurance policies may cover some aspects of art protection, they often fall short when it comes to the unique risks faced by art collectors. art risk life insurance provides specialized coverage for things like accidental damage, theft, vandalism, and even mysterious disappearance of the art piece.

Another important aspect of art risk life insurance is the coverage for restoration and conservation of the art piece. In the unfortunate event that the art piece is damaged, having insurance coverage for restoration and conservation can be crucial in ensuring that the piece is properly restored to its original state. Art restoration can be a complex and delicate process, requiring specialized knowledge and expertise, as well as significant financial investment. Having insurance coverage for restoration can help ease the financial burden and ensure that the art piece is restored to its full value.

Additionally, art risk life insurance can provide coverage for loss of value in case the art piece is damaged or devalued in some way. This type of coverage is particularly important for art collectors who invest in valuable art pieces as a form of long-term investment. In the event that the art piece loses value due to damage or other factors, art risk life insurance can provide coverage to compensate for the loss in value.

Furthermore, art risk life insurance can also provide coverage for legal expenses in case of disputes over ownership or authenticity of the art piece. Art disputes can be complex and costly to resolve, often involving legal battles and expert opinions. Having insurance coverage for legal expenses can help protect art collectors from the financial burden of resolving such disputes and ensure that their interests are protected.
